If there is nothing in the Italian Parliament that could prevent the Vatican to impose a theocratic regime in Italy, still remains the bulwark of the Constitutional Court. That on April 1 has partially rejected Law 40 on artificial insemination for constitutional illegitimacy on article 14, paragraph 2, which provides an "unique, contemporary implantation, of not more than three embryos, and paragraph 3, which provides that the transfer of embryos has to be done as soon as possible "without prejudice to the health of the woman."
The recourse came from the administrative court of Lazio and the Court of Florence, which had been adressed by the World association of reproductive medicine (Warm) of Professor Severino Antinori, and by a couple of Milan suffering from a serious genetic disease, who with law 40 would be  condemned, as all couples who have similar diseases, to take the risk of generating sick children, even if modern medicine could easily avoid that.  The law 40 is still partially standing, and still completely wrong. The decision of the Court eliminates at least in part the unconstitutional unequal treatment of women in different physical conditions that rely on artificial insemination, but continues to restrict the freedom of women to decide for themselves and their children. Continues to restrict the ability of doctors to make the best decision to protect the future health of the mother and the unborn child without being subjected to irrational prohibitions. Remains in the law the impossibility to use ovules or semen from donors unrelated to the couple, even brothers and sisters, an opportunity that would be vital for couples with serious problems of infertility.
